Barbara Anne (Cook) Olmstead, died on September 20, 2023. She was 79.
Barbara was born on March 5, 1944, to parents William and Geraldine Baldwin, in Seattle, Washington. The family moved to California and settled in Watsonville where she attended local schools and graduated from Watsonville High School.
She met and married Carl Olmstead. Soon she welcomed her beloved only child, daughter Tammy. She worked for Corralitos Electric for over 20 years and then worked as a cake decorator for Safeway Supermarket for many years until her retirement.
Barbara enjoyed gardening, crocheting, sewing, and cooking. But most of all, she loved spending time with her grandchildren, whom she loved dearly. Barbara bravely fought chronic lymphocytic leukemia for 30 years. She was an incredibly strong woman and will be missed deeply by her family and friends.
She is survived by her daughter, Tammy Olmstead, two grandchildren, and her sister Nettie Cook.
